梅雁吉祥(600868) - 2018 Q2 - 季度财报
MEI YANMEI YAN(SH:600868)2018-08-16 16:00

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first half of 2018 was CNY 94,346,227.97, a decrease of 18.67% compared to CNY 115,999,575.78 in the same period last year[17]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for the first half of 2018 was CNY 6,766,149.20, representing a significant decline of 93.84% from CNY 109,793,557.99 in the previous year[17]. - The net cash flow from operating activities decreased by 60.04%, amounting to CNY 15,675,357.85, down from CNY 39,231,473.71 in the same period last year[17]. - The company's basic earnings per share for the first half of 2018 was CNY 0.0036, a decrease of 93.77% compared to CNY 0.0578 in the previous year[18]. - The weighted average return on net assets dropped to 0.29% from 4.66%, a decrease of 4.37 percentage points[18]. - The company's total assets at the end of the reporting period were CNY 2,346,790,476.03, down 2.21% from CNY 2,399,892,905.03 at the end of the previous year[17]. - The company reported a decrease in net assets attributable to shareholders by 1.35%, totaling CNY 2,272,526,704.69 at the end of the reporting period[17]. - The company's total assets amounted to CNY 2,346,790,476.03, with net assets attributable to shareholders at CNY 2,272,526,704.69, and total operating revenue of CNY 94,346,227.97, resulting in a net profit of CNY 6,766,149.20[26]. - The operating revenue decreased by 18.67% compared to the previous period, primarily due to a 46.99% reduction in rainfall, which significantly impacted power generation[27]. - The company reported a net loss of RMB 96,942,245.53 for the period, compared to a loss of RMB 65,745,421.15 at the beginning of the period[96]. Cash Flow and Investments - Cash flow from operating activities decreased due to a decline in operating income, leading to reduced cash received from sales and services[34]. - The total cash flow from investment activities decreased due to reduced cash recovered from investments and increased cash paid for securities investments[34]. - The company’s total profit for the first half of 2018 was CNY 4,791,459.94, down from CNY 122,393,618.22 in the same period last year, reflecting a decrease of approximately 96.1%[106]. - The net cash flow from investment activities was 12,819,887.07 CNY, compared to 176,533,132.87 CNY in the previous period, indicating a significant decrease[112]. - The total cash inflow from financing activities was 54,973,500.15 CNY, while the cash outflow was 82,750,273.58 CNY, resulting in a net cash flow of -27,776,773.43 CNY[112]. Operational Highlights - The rainfall in the area where the company's power stations are located decreased by 46.99% compared to the same period last year, leading to a 47.00% reduction in power generation revenue[19]. - The company initiated the commercial operation of the Meifeng B plant, which is expected to increase annual power generation by approximately 35 million kWh and generate additional revenue of about CNY 15 million[28]. - The company has made strategic investments, including acquiring a 4.69% stake in the Jiaoling County Rural Credit Cooperative for CNY 13.776 million[29]. - The management emphasizes the importance of maintaining stable operations in hydropower while exploring clean energy development projects[31]. - The company has implemented measures to enhance the efficiency of power generation equipment and ensure safe production operations[29]. Risk Factors - The company anticipates significant fluctuations in cumulative net profit compared to the previous year due to the decrease in non-recurring gains[48]. - The company faces policy risks due to changes in national macroeconomic policies and electricity market reforms, which may impact future operations[49]. - Hydropower revenue is subject to rainfall variability, leading to income uncertainty; the company also faces risks from fluctuations in manufacturing product prices affecting rental income[50]. Environmental Compliance - The company has not reported any environmental violations or required rectifications during the reporting period, indicating compliance with environmental protection measures[79]. - The company has established an emergency response plan for environmental incidents, ensuring timely action and damage mitigation, with no incidents reported during the period[77]. - The company’s subsidiary, Meiyan Xuanjiao Cement Co., Ltd., has implemented effective pollution control measures, including dust collection and denitrification facilities, with normal operational status throughout the reporting period[78]. - The company has obtained the necessary environmental permits and completed environmental impact assessments for its construction projects[76].
